openclaw --help и официальную документацию: релизы в начале 2026 года меняются быстро.
01Предпроверка: macOS, диск, сеть и фиксированный IP
Сопоставьте версию macOS и требования upstream к toolchain. Для сборки из исходников часто нужны актуальные Xcode или хотя бы Command Line Tools; выполните xcodebuild -version и сверьте с README выбранного тега, потому что матрица зависимостей меняется между релизами OpenClaw и Node.js.
- Свободное место: держите не менее десяти гигабайт запаса поверх установщика, иначе упираетесь в распаковку артефактов Gateway, журналы и кэш пакетного менеджера.
- Сеть: заранее решите нужен ли стабильный egress IP для allow list партнёров; на арендованных хостах пул адресов иногда ротируется.
- Учётные записи: зафиксируйте под каким пользователем пойдёт демон после
openclaw onboard --install-daemon, иначе TCC и launchd дадут тихий отказ без явного кода выхода в скрипте.
02Ветка A: однострочный curl и ожидаемые сигналы
Публичный путь установки: curl -fsSL https://openclaw.ai/install.sh | bash. Успех — завершение без ненулевого кода, появление бинарника openclaw в PATH и понятные строки версии. Провал — ошибки TLS, отсутствие прав sudo или блокировка исходящего HTTPS на уровне провайдера аренды.
Ветка B: Homebrew. Выполните brew install openclaw/tap/openclaw, затем openclaw init и openclaw start. После каждого bump делайте смоук, потому что ABI Node может сдвинуться незаметно для CI.
Ветка C: изоляция. Docker на macOS для OpenClaw — продвинутая схема: проверяйте монтирование каталогов с конфигом ~/.openclaw/openclaw.json и доступ к сокетам; держите параллельный bare metal стенд для сравнения регрессий.
openclaw --help на конкретной машине и официальному сайту проекта.03US West или APAC: консоль против региона API
Размещение удалённого Mac — двухосевая задача: операторам важны SSH и отклик браузера к dashboard, а агенту — задержка исходящих TLS к облачным моделям и SaaS. Сопоставьте карту вызовов и выберите узел под более горячую ось.
| Сигнал | Узел US West | Узел APAC |
|---|---|---|
| Операторы в Северной Америке | Ниже RTT к SSH и VNC | Выше интерактивная задержка даже при нормальных API |
| Плотный трафик к типовым US API | Часто короче рукопожатие TLS | Следите за хвостом на больших загрузках |
| Команды в Сеуле Токио Сингапуре | Ночные смены могут компенсировать | Удобнее живой контур с человеком в цикле |
04Параллельные инстансы против одной толстой машины
Два Mac mini M4 с разделением ролей снижают радиус поражения: один держит стабильный production Gateway, второй — canary с экспериментальными плагинами. Один мощный хост выигрывает при общих тяжёлых кэшах моделей на локальном SSD; измеряйте wall clock и стоимость аренды перед выбором.
Оформление второго узла и дисков смотрите в корзине и на тарифах; нюансы доступа — в справочном центре.
05Диск: логи, кэш моделей, npm и pnpm
Направьте каталоги логов туда где возможна ротация без простоя Gateway. Кэши npm и pnpm держите на быстром томе, но мониторьте рост; тяжёлые артефакты моделей выносите из корневого раздела согласно рекомендациям версии OpenClaw.
Основной конфиг обычно ожидается в ~/.openclaw/openclaw.json; после мажорного обновления сравните файл с примером из документации. При нехватке места расширяйте диск по актуальному прайсу neokvm, не надеясь на внешний USB в облаке.
Шаг 1. Зафиксируйте целевые API и регион узла neokvm под задержку операторов и исходящий трафик.
Шаг 2. Установите OpenClaw через curl или brew и проверьте нулевой код выхода установщика.
Шаг 3. Выполните init и start затем при необходимости onboard с демоном и проверьте launchd логи.
Шаг 4. Настройте dashboard только через безопасный канал например SSH port forwarding.
Шаг 5. Зафиксируйте smoke тест Gateway и команду lsof на порту из актуального конфига.
06Отладка: Gateway Starting, порт 18789, TCC, откат версии
- Порт: выполните
lsof -nP -iTCP:18789 | grep LISTENчтобы увидеть конкурирующий процесс на типовом порту Gateway. - TCC: удалённая сессия не отменяет запросы приватности macOS; проверьте Full Disk Access для родительского терминала и пользователя демона.
- Версии: при несовпадении Node и нативных модулей откатите brew или переустановите предыдущий билд; читайте stderr до обвинения внешних rate limit.
07Рабочий поток: SSH и локальный dashboard
Типичный паттерн: ноутбук инженера подключается по SSH к удалённому Mac, на хосте запускается OpenClaw, затем openclaw dashboard согласно актуальному выводу справки CLI на этой версии.
Не публикуйте dashboard в открытый интернет без TLS и аутентификации; предпочитайте локальный port forwarding через SSH чтобы UI оставался на localhost пока трафик идёт по шифрованному туннелю. Периодически ротируйте API ключи потому что агентский хост концентрирует секреты.
08Цифры для вставки в проектную документацию
09FAQ для занятых SRE
Нужен ли полный Xcode из App Store для каждой установки? Только если вы собираете нативные расширения по матрице upstream; быстрый curl путь может ограничиться CLT. Всегда читайте таблицу для вашего тега.
Где истина по подкомандам? После каждого обновления запускайте openclaw --help и сравнивайте release notes.
Кто поддерживает сам OpenClaw? NeoKVM отвечает за железо удалённого Mac сеть и панель аренды; дефекты продукта OpenClaw эскалируйте мейнтейнерам и внутреннему runbook.
Готовы зафиксировать инфраструктуру: откройте страницу покупки, выберите узел US West или APAC под карту API и операторов, затем согласуйте диски с тарифами. Операционные вопросы плоскости управления — в справке.
Арендуйте US West или APAC Mac mini M4 под OpenClaw
Разведите canary и production на двух скромных хостах или расширьте диск под тяжёлые кэши моделей. Глобальный каталог оформления: neokvm.com/purchase.html; сверка планов: neokvm.com/pricing.html.